  • Patent number: 8619778
    Abstract: There is described a method for automatic address allocation to at least one communication partner encompassed by a network, whereby a primary communication partner likewise encompassed by the network transfers a data item to the, or one of the, communication partner(s) and whereby the communication partner in question performs a comparison of the data item with a reference data item. Depending on the result of the comparison, either an address is assigned to the communication partner in question or the data item is transferred to a communication partner downstream of the communication partner in question in the network and the data item is modified in conjunction with the transfer of the data item to the downstream communication partner. There is also described a communication partner as well as an automation system for executing the method as well as an automation system with such a communication partner.

  • Patent number: 8060672
    Abstract: There is described a method, a bus protocol, a peripheral module, a processing unit, a hub and also to a system consisting of said components, for event signaling between at least one peripheral module and a processing unit by means of a system bus. In this case the data to be transmitted data is encoded into a larger symbol space, from which a standard idle symbol is used in telegram pauses for synchronizing a connection between transmitter and receiver. A message present at the peripheral modules is enabled to be signaled to the processing unit independently of the telegram traffic initiated by the processing unit.

  • Patent number: 8015324
    Abstract: The invention relates to a method for data transmission in a serial bus system comprising a control unit and bus users. The method comprises steps: receiving a first data telegram by a bus user from the control unit, wherein the data telegram has a data field containing output data; reading out the data field intended for the bus user from the first data telegram; preparing input data as a response to the read out data field; checking whether a predefined criterion is met, wherein if the criterion is met a second data telegram is newly generated and the input data is attached to the second data telegram and if the criterion is not met, the input data is attached to a data telegram previously received from another bus user; and transmitting the input data to the control unit by the second data telegram.

  • Patent number: 7843966
    Abstract: There is described a module for expanding a central module of an automation system, the data transfer between module and central module being accomplished by means of a serial communication system having point-to-point connections in a daisychain or backplane layout and the module having, in a physical layer herefor, at least two transmitters and at least two receivers. There is also described a communication system having at least one module of said kind and a central module. A module for a communication system within an automation system is specified, which module can be flexibly and easily adapted to the respective field of application. There is further described a flexible and scalable communication system for the data transfer between a central module/a CPU and at least one module with the aim of realizing a modular expansion of the central module/CPU.

  • Patent number: 7583690
    Abstract: The invention relates to a method for simplified allocation of station addresses to communication users in a bus system, and communication users in a bus system. A first communication user, which can automatically transmit to the bus, can allocate data to a station address, said data clearly identifying another communication user, or characterizing a station address as non-occupied. An additional communication user who has already sent a data packet with clearly identifying data to the first communication user in an earlier communication cycle by means of said communication user and who receives a data packet comprising data in a later communication cycle, whereby said data does not clearly identify said communication user, can automatically alter the station address thereof in a station address characterized as not being occupied.

  • Publication number: 20030099229
    Abstract: The invention relates to an electrical device (LNK) which has means (DP-S, K′) for forming a communication connection to a field bus (DP) and additional means (PA-M, FF-M, K) for forming a communication connection to an additional field bus (PAFF). Said device is thus presented as a combination of three communication stations (DP-S, PA-M, FF-M) for the respective connection to a field bus (DP, PA, FF).

  • Patent number: 5927218
    Abstract: A buffer circuit of a decentralized peripheral module. The buffer circuit has three input and three output signal storage areas, which can be selectively connected to a bus interface or a module interface via a selection circuit. Thus the process signal transfer from an intelligent unit arranged on the module to a unit of a higher level than the module and vice-versa can be completely separated.
